Output 1588c97ef547d8f97e7e219104c405d4240c63172689ce585262731ffe103370:5

value
652642595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e8a5c44e1c5f30ce1501a208998797d3bdd23f1 OP_EQUAL
address
MC9F4hrxyTNLhJRsJNNMaQaCnzFoxqVENe
transaction
1588c97ef547d8f97e7e219104c405d4240c63172689ce585262731ffe103370
spent
true